> I've not worked with a Digi001 first hand. I recall discussions on
other forums regarding
> the integrated MIDI Interface onthe Digi 001 - and a quick Google
turns up some old
> posts, so I suspect what you are experiencing is what I eluded to
in a previous reply: the
> bulk transfer is dropping SysEx packets enroute to your AN1x.
>
> The reasons for this are varied and a quick search of the list
archives will show this has
> been a long standing concern. The AN1x SysEx dumps are unusually
large in size - more
> so than the average synthesizer - and this is design limitation on
Yamaha's part that will
> not be revisited. This issue has dogged users of both platforms -
particularly in the case
> of USB MIDI Interfaces - and we've had many discussions
recommending one MIDI
> Interface or the other. I suspect the drivers for the Digi001 have
not seen an update (or wil
> see an update) for many years - introduced in 2000, wasn't it?
>
> Sorry this isn't much help, if you have the opportunity to try
another MIDI Interface I would
> suggest doing so (I use a discontinued Emagic MT4 and it works a
treat!)
